The piriformis muscle connects the lowermost vertebrae with the upper part of the leg after traveling the "sciatic notch," the opening in the pelvic bone that allows the sciatic nerve to travel into the leg. Here, the muscle and nerve are adjacent and this proximity is why trouble can develop.
Your piriformis muscle runs from your lower spine to the top of your thigh bone. Piriformis syndrome occurs when this muscle presses on your sciatic nerve (the nerve that goes from your spinal cord to your buttocks and down the back of each leg). This can cause pain and numbness in your lower body.

Description. Piriformis is a flat muscle and the most superficial muscle of the deep gluteal muscles. It is part of the lateral rotators of the hip (obturator internus, superior and inferior gemelli, quadratus femoris, obturator externus, and gluteus maximus).
While both conditions interfere with sciatic nerve function, sciatica results from spinal dysfunction such as a herniated disc or spinal stenosis. Piriformis syndrome, on the other hand, occurs when the piriformis muscle, located deep in the buttock, compresses the sciatic nerve.
The piriformis muscle is a flat, band-like muscle located in the buttocks near the top of the hip joint. This muscle is important in lower body movement because it stabilizes the hip joint and lifts and rotates the thigh away from the body.
Causes of Piriformis Syndrome Suspected causes include: Muscle spasm in the piriformis muscle, either because of irritation in the piriformis muscle itself, or irritation of a nearby structure such as the sacroiliac joint or hip. Tightening of the muscle, in response to injury or spasm.
Piriformis syndrome is a condition in which the piriformis muscle entraps the sciatic nerve. It is part of a wider condition called deep gluteal syndrome. It can cause pain, tingling, and numbness, and can be temporary or chronic.

This is the official approximate match mapping between ICD9 and ICD10, as provided by the General Equivalency mapping crosswalk. This means that while there is no exact mapping between this ICD10 code G57.00 and a single ICD9 code, 355.0 is an approximate match for comparison and conversion purposes.
The ICD code G570 is used to code Piriformis syndrome. Diagnosis is often difficult due to few validated and standardized diagnostic tests, but two have been well-described and clinically validated: one is electrophysiological, called the FAIR-test, which measures delay in sciatic nerve conductions when the piriformis muscle is stretched against it.:41 .
